MDEV-5995 MySQL Bug#12750920: EMBEDDED SERVER START/STOP.
Some variables weren't cleared properly so consequitive embedded server start/stop failed. Cleanups added. Also mysql_client_test.c extended to test that (taken from Mattias Johnson's patch)
